How the body moves is closely related to the interaction of the muscular, skeletal, and nervous systems. Muscles contract to produce movement, while bones provide structure and support, allowing for a range of motions. The nervous system coordinates these movements by sending signals to the muscles, ensuring precise and controlled actions. Additionally, factors such as flexibility, strength, and balance play crucial roles in determining overall movement efficiency and effectiveness.
